About Bulgogi Brothers Pattaya

Bulgogi Brothers is a modern Korean BBQ restaurant on Pattaya 2nd Road. A group destination for self-grill pork belly, beef galbi and full Korean BBQ feasts.

Modern Korean BBQ restaurant on 2nd Road. Suits groups grilling pork belly and beef galbi.

Why visit Bulgogi Brothers Pattaya

  • Tableside self-grill BBQ format with smokeless extractor hoods, the modern Korean BBQ format rare outside Bangkok
  • Pork belly, beef galbi and Korean wagyu cuts from imported Korean and Australian sources
  • Banchan side-dish set of eight small dishes refilled free with each BBQ order, the genuine Korean restaurant standard
  • 2nd Road central location places the restaurant within five minutes' walk of major Beach Road hotels
  • Set BBQ menus priced from 599 baht per person, fair for a true self-grill Korean BBQ tier with quality cuts
